1. Vitamin C

Vitamin C isn’t only vital for overall health however, it’s also an effective solution for dental bacteria since its antioxidant properties help fight infections and help build strong gums, according to Dr. Louie who suggests that people who have bleeding gums should think about taking a Vitamin C supplement.

Vitamin C is a water-soluble vitamin present in vegetables and fruits. For optimal health benefits It is recommended that you consume at minimum 75 mg of Vitamin C every day.

However, it is essential to remember that the most effective way to boost your intake of vitamin C is to consume fresh fruits and vegetables such as spinach, carrots and oranges. Foods that aren’t laced with sugar tend to be more natural sources of this essential nutrient, so making sure you include these ingredients in your meals and snacks can be beneficial.

A diet that is rich in Vitamin C is the best method to protect yourself from dental problems. Additionally, this eating plan boosts your immune system since it can help fight infections.

Vitamin C’s antioxidant properties are vital for the production of collagen. This helps maintain periodontal structures such as the gingiva, periodontal ligament and cementum as well as alveolar bone. Furthermore it is able to ease inflammation in the mouth and aid in the healing of periodontal tissues.

3. Zinc

Zinc is a vital mineral that is essential for maintaining good dental health. It has several advantages including the prevention of gum disease.

It helps protect against inflammation and cell membrane breakdown caused by bacteria that cause gingivitis. Furthermore, it inhibits the production of hydrogen peroxide which can cause irritation to the mouth when inhaled.

Zinc is found in abundance in the dental hard tissues including dental enamel. The enamel of your teeth is made up of calcium hydroxyapatite with the crystalline structure zinc aids in creating. The result is that your enamel becomes harder and more resistant dental caries.

Zinc toothpaste is proven scientifically to reduce plaque and calculus formation, thereby protecting the teeth against decay as well as tooth loss. In addition, it can reduce acid production as well as encourage remineralization, which strengthens enamel.

In addition, it reduces the odor caused due to volatile sulfur compounds (VSCs) within your mouth. This smell occurs when bacteria digest food leftovers in your mouth and release the gas.
